Fraud Prevention Specialist

Remote · USA Full-time New today

A Fraud Prevention Specialist is responsible for identifying, investigating, and preventing fraudulent activities that may impact an organizations financial assets, customers, and reputation. The role involves monitoring transactions, analyzing suspicious behavior, conducting investigations, and implementing fraud risk controls. The specialist works closely with risk management, compliance, operations, and customer service teams to minimize fraud losses and ensure regulatory compliance.

Key Duties and Responsibilities

  • Monitor transactions and account activities for suspicious patterns

  • Review and investigate fraud alerts generated by monitoring systems

  • Analyze data to detect fraud trends and emerging risks

  • Verify suspicious transactions with customers when necessary

  • Document investigation findings and maintain accurate case records

  • Recommend account restrictions, transaction blocks, or escalations

  • Support compliance with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and internal policies

  • Assist in improving fraud detection tools and prevention strategies

  • Prepare reports on fraud cases and trends for management review
